The Los Angeles County Museum of Art hosted its 14th annual Art+Film Gala. The star-studded event honored director Ryan Coogler and artist Mary Corse. It was held on the museum grounds in Los Angeles.

Sponsored by Gucci, the gala united leaders from art, film, and fashion. According to Getty Images coverage, co-chairs Leonardo DiCaprio and Eva Chow helped welcome the guests. The evening set a new fundraising record for the institution.
Hollywood and Art World Converge for Landmark Evening
The guest list featured an unparalleled mix of creatives. Filmmaker Ava DuVernay, musician Doja Cat, and artist Mark Bradford were among the attendees. Models like Kaia Gerber and Vittoria Ceretti added to the fashionable atmosphere.
The program was briefly delayed by the World Series. Guests cheered when the Los Angeles Dodgers won the championship. Dinner was then served by Michelin-starred chef David Shim.
Honorees Celebrated for Profound Cultural Impact
Artist James Turrell praised Mary Corse as a “keeper of the light.” Angela Bassett then took the stage to honor her Black Panther director, Ryan Coogler. She highlighted his unique ability to balance epic storytelling with intimate moments.
Coogler delivered an emotional speech about finding community in Los Angeles. He recalled his first visit to LACMA as a broke USC student. The filmmaker credited the museum for providing inspiration throughout his career.
The record-breaking $6.5 million raised will significantly expand LACMA’s film initiatives. This ensures the museum remains a vital hub for cinematic and visual arts. The event’s success underscores Los Angeles’s unique position at the intersection of art and film.
